Definitions

  1. 1. to adopt (a method, proposal, etc.)
  2. 2. to take (a measure, course of action, etc.)
  3. 3. to pick (e.g. flowers)
  4. 4. to extract (e.g. juice)
This verb means to collect, gather, or select something, such as picking herbs, harvesting samples, or choosing candidates. It is often used in scientific, agricultural, or hiring contexts, and should be distinguished from other words also read とる.
